Re: `sweeper/orphan_scan.go` — the sweep logic looks correct, but please note for support triage: the sweeper only deletes resources whose parent record has been gone longer than the grace window, so tickets about "missing" assets inside that window are expected behavior, not data loss. Deletions are logged with the orphan's age, and a dry-run mode exists for verification. One ask: move the hardcoded thresholds into the config block, currently set as follows.

tuning table, kajog-bawip:
TIERS = {
    "kelius": 256,
    "lammir": 543,
}

## v4.2.0 — Renamed render-cache setting

For newcomers: the template engine Quillfast caches compiled templates, and the old setting `TPL_CACHE` was ambiguous (bytes? entries?). It is now `QUILLFAST_CACHE_ENTRIES`, counting compiled templates held in memory. Benchmarks on the Larkmoor cluster showed a 30% render speedup at 5,000 entries. The renderer also needs its cache-bus credential at boot, which the env file sets on the next line.

env line for fafof-fahag: LEDGER_TOKEN5=f8790

## Per-Tenant Rate Quotas

Every plugin running on the Hollowgate platform is subject to per-tenant rate quotas enforced at the ingress layer. Default limits are 500 requests per minute per tenant, with burst allowance up to 750 for 30 seconds. If your plugin exceeds its quota, responses return a retry-after header that you must honor; aggressive retries trigger an automatic 15-minute penalty window. Quota increases require a capacity review. Current limits and the request form are on the internal page below.

operations page: https://jenkins.zemvarcloud.local/job/merge_requests/repo/build/73930b4b30f0a8ed